Output 68c199c688626d742a44015878afddfcd6a83a5d0f8081c9158ea4a48275b693:0

value
337311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 493306617cbf5916f8d3f18db8e9c0ea6d95ef6f OP_EQUAL
address
38N4NpbAqJvN6wisnR4SazXb2BGmwoD7bt
transaction
68c199c688626d742a44015878afddfcd6a83a5d0f8081c9158ea4a48275b693
confirmations
281445
spent
true